Buying a Sleeper Sofa With Storage
Sleeper sofas or sofa beds are an excellent option for those who have guests over often. There are a variety of options including futons, armless sleepers, click-clack sofa beds Trundle sofa beds, and more.
Most sleeper sofas appear like traditional couches, and feature an under-the-bed mattress that can be converted into beds. Some sleeper sofas come with storage compartments for bedding as well as extra pillows.
1. Convenience
A sleeper sofa is a great option for any living space particularly if you host more overnight guests than guest rooms, or live in a studio apartment. The hidden mattress can transform seating into a bed quickly so guests can get an adequate night's sleep. Sofa beds are available in a variety styles from modern to traditional. Select one that complements the style and color of your living space to create a harmonious look.
If you are looking for a sleeper sofa, make sure it is constructed of strong materials. They must be capable of enduring wear and tear. The frames upholstery, joints, and cushion fillings must be of high quality to prevent ripping or damage. Some manufacturers offer upholstery with stain and moisture-resistant finishes to protect the fabric from spills.
It is also essential to think about the type of mattress that will come with your sleeper sofa. Certain mattresses are made of latex or memory foam, while others are made with foam and innerspring. The size of the mattress is crucial, particularly when it's a sectional. You'll need to ensure that the mattress is big enough for your guests to enjoy an enjoyable night's rest.
Some of our sleeper sofas feature built-in storage. They are great to store extra pillows, blankets and other bedding items so they're easy to reach when guests arrive. There's also storage behind the chaise portion of the sofa, which is ideal to store magazines, books and other living room essentials.
When you're ready to purchase a sleeper sofa, it's important to visit a reputable furniture retailer in order to test the couch for yourself. This is a big purchase, so you'll want to make sure that the sofa fits your space and is comfortable for sitting and sleeping. If possible, test out the sleeper sofa on the showroom floor repeatedly to get a feel for how it opens and closes, and how it's simple to set up. You'll also want to check the quality of the mechanism, comfort level and if it has a pull-out feature.
2. Style

Whether you're furnishing an extra room for guests or seeking a comfy spot to relax and watch a show, a sleeper sofa can be an ideal and stylish option. These versatile couches transform into beds to accommodate guests who stay overnight, giving you the option of turning any room to a bedroom when necessary.
There are a variety of styles available to pick from for queen-sized sleepers, which can be as large as 54 inches wide and 85 inches long when opened. You can also pick the twin-sized bed, which is compact and better suited for smaller rooms.
When looking for a sleeper sofa select a style that fits your home and lifestyle. A leather sofa can go well with modern and contemporary decor, while a fabric couch might be better for traditional and transitional decor. Consider the type of mattress, which is often determined by the size of the sleeper sofa.
The majority of sleeper sofas have an innerspring or high-density foam mattress. Gel memory foam is cooler and offers the same comfort as memory foam, however it's less expensive. Latex is bouncy and comfortable and is more eco-friendly than other kinds.
Although the majority of sleeper sofas come with an easy-to-use mechanism for pulling out the mattress It's a good idea to try the pull-out method in a store if it's possible. Check that the mechanism is sturdy and that when you push it back in, the mattress will stay in place. You should look for a system that has bars and springs that are not too heavy and a design that prevents the mattress from tilting.

3. Comfort
A sleeper sofa is a piece of furniture which can be transformed into a comfortable bed for guests. They are perfect for apartments or condos, as well as homes that don't have enough space to create a guest room. They typically have an inner mattress that is hidden inside the frame that can be removed with a handle when guests are ready to stay. affordable sleeper couches can find them in many different fabrics, so you're sure to find one that matches your furniture and decor.
It's important, as with any major furniture purchase, to research and shop around to make sure you're making the right choice. Compare features and prices of different models, and pay particular attention to the type of mattress you'll get. Most sleeper sofas are equipped with a foam mattress. However, you may want to upgrade to the gel memory foam, air-over coil, or a latex mattress. These options offer pressure point relief and an effervescent feel than traditional spring mattresses.
Before you make a final decision you should consider the dimensions of your space into account. Make sure you fit the sofa through any doorways and into the room where it will be placed. Be sure to read the shipping and return policies of any online retailer you are contemplating. This will save you from any fees that aren't expected or long waiting times when getting your new sofa delivered to your home.
